Join us!

Arts of Life advances the creative arts community by providing artists with intellectual and developmental disabilities a collective space to expand their practice and strengthen their leadership.

POSITION PURPOSE The Arts Marketing is responsible for working under the direction of our arts coordinator to develop, facilitate and maintain the current marketing objectives. R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Marketing Plan & Development- Develop a working marketing plan to include objectives, timelines and responsible parties for new opportunities.
  • Galleries & Arts Organizations- Submit proposals for exhibitions.
  • Consignment-Develop a working plan to increase our consignment opportunities with existing and new partners

QUALIFICATIONS

  • Strong written and verbal skills
  • Organized
  • Excellent time management skills
  • Marketing experience a plus
  • Strong research skills
  • Comfortable in using the MAC platform

Mission Statement

Arts of Life advances the creative arts community by providing artists with intellectual and developmental disabilities a collective space to expand their practice and strengthen their leadership.

Description

Arts of Life is a non profit organization committed to providing high quality, innovative services for adults with developmental disabilities. Our community is arts based and focused on the growth of its artists through the creation of a supportive environment.
